Output 31d6507434d3cfac06655d23773abd28000bba90e6fcba7aa5772544b2c1d12b:1

value
941382
script pubkey
OP_0 OP_PUSHBYTES_20 347962f2b85405137d730dc58ae413e3770bfd1f
address
ltc1qx3uk9u4c2sz3xltnphzc4eqnudmshlglqe0nv6
transaction
31d6507434d3cfac06655d23773abd28000bba90e6fcba7aa5772544b2c1d12b
spent
true